What's the difference between Medicare Advantage and a Supplement plan?

Medicare Advantage (Part C) bundles your Medicare coverage into one plan, often with extra benefits like dental, vision, and drug coverage, using a network of providers. A Medicare Supplement (Medigap) plan works alongside Original Medicare to help pay costs it doesn't cover and lets you see any provider that accepts Medicare, but doesn't include drug coverage.

What does a Medicare star rating mean?

Every year Medicare rates plans on a 1-to-5 star scale based on quality of care and member experience. A higher rating suggests better performance. Five-star plans can also be joined outside the usual enrollment periods through a Five-Star Special Enrollment Period.
